Understanding Signal's Privacy Features
Signal has cultivated a reputation as one of the most secure communication platforms available, and its dedication to privacy is evident in its extensive feature set. Numerous users are drawn to Signal because of its end-to-end security , which ensures that only the sender and receiver can access the content of their messages . Beyond basic encryption, Signal offers additional levels of privacy, including disappearing communications, which automatically delete after a set period. You can further safeguard your account with registration lock, requiring a passcode to access, and enable screenshot prevention to deter unwanted copying of your exchanges .

Signal Protocol Explained: A Deep Analysis
The Messaging Protocol, designed by Open Whisper Systems, represents a vital advancement in secure protection. It's no single method, but rather a suite of cryptographic processes working in unison to provide reliable confidentiality for chats . Key to its design are the use of paired ratchet algorithms for all transmissions and group chats, meaning that each interaction is encrypted using a new password, drastically limiting the impact of a single key breach . This method also incorporates retroactive secrecy, so even if a earlier key is compromised , later messages remain secure .
